A medial meniscus tear is a common knee injury where the C-shaped cartilage on the inner side of your knee joint gets damaged. This cartilage acts as a shock absorber and stabilizer between your thighbone and shinbone, and when it tears, you typically feel pain along the inner edge of your knee, often with swelling, stiffness, or a sensation that the knee is catching or locking during movement.
What the Medial Meniscus Does
Your knee has two menisci, one on each side. The medial meniscus sits on the inner side, and the lateral meniscus sits on the outer side. These are tough, rubbery wedges of cartilage that distribute your body weight across the knee joint, absorb impact when you walk or run, and help keep the joint stable. Without them, the forces of everyday movement would concentrate on small areas of bone, wearing down the joint surface much faster.
The medial meniscus is less mobile than the lateral one, which makes it more vulnerable to injury. It’s anchored more tightly to surrounding structures, so when the knee twists or absorbs a sudden load, the medial side takes more of the strain.
How These Tears Happen
In younger, active people, medial meniscus tears usually result from a forceful twist of the knee while the foot is planted. This is common in sports that involve pivoting, cutting, or sudden direction changes, like soccer, basketball, and football. A deep squat or an awkward landing can also do it.
In people over 40, tears often develop gradually. The meniscus loses water content and becomes more brittle with age, so even minor movements like getting up from a chair or stepping off a curb can cause a tear. These are called degenerative tears, and they sometimes develop without a single memorable injury.
Types of Medial Meniscus Tears
Not all tears look the same, and the pattern matters because it affects whether the tear can heal on its own or needs surgery.
- Longitudinal tear: Runs vertically along the length of the meniscus, parallel to its curved shape. If this type extends far enough, the torn flap can flip into the center of the joint, creating what’s called a bucket-handle tear, which often locks the knee.
- Horizontal tear: Splits the meniscus into an upper and lower layer, running parallel to the flat surface of the shinbone. These are more common in older adults with degenerative changes.
- Radial tear: Cuts perpendicularly across the body of the meniscus, disrupting its ability to distribute load effectively.
- Oblique (parrot-beak) tear: Runs at an angle through the meniscus. A loose flap from this type of tear can catch between the bones during movement.
What It Feels Like
The hallmark symptom is pain along the inner joint line of the knee, right in the crease where the bones meet. Swelling usually develops within a day or two of the injury. Many people can still walk on a torn meniscus, especially in the first few days, but certain movements make the pain worse: twisting, squatting, or going up and down stairs.
Two sensations are particularly characteristic. One is mechanical locking, where the knee physically gets stuck and you can’t straighten it fully. This happens when a flap of torn cartilage wedges between the bones. The other is a feeling of the knee “giving way,” where the joint suddenly feels unstable, as though it might buckle. You might also notice a clicking or popping sensation when bending the knee.
How It’s Diagnosed
A doctor will typically start with a physical exam, pressing along the inner joint line for tenderness and performing specific maneuvers to stress the meniscus. During the McMurray test, you lie on your back while the examiner bends and rotates your knee, feeling for a click or pain that suggests a tear. The Thessaly test takes a different approach: you stand on one leg with a slight knee bend and twist your body inward and outward three times while the examiner supports your arms. Pain or a catching sensation during either test points toward a meniscus injury.
MRI is the standard imaging tool for confirming the diagnosis. For medial meniscus tears specifically, MRI has a sensitivity of about 95% and a specificity of about 94%, meaning it catches nearly all tears and rarely flags a healthy meniscus as torn. X-rays won’t show a meniscus tear since cartilage doesn’t appear on X-ray, but they can rule out fractures or arthritis.
When Surgery Isn’t Needed
Many medial meniscus tears, particularly degenerative tears and small stable tears, respond well to conservative treatment. The goal is to reduce pain and swelling first, then rebuild strength in the muscles that support the knee.
Strengthening the quadriceps (the muscles at the front of your thigh) is one of the most important parts of rehab, because strong quads reduce the stress your meniscus has to absorb. Exercises targeting the glute muscles also help by improving control during single-leg movements like walking and climbing stairs. A typical program starts with non-weight-bearing exercises like stationary cycling to build muscle without stressing the joint, then progresses to weight-bearing exercises like squats and stair climbing as symptoms allow. Pool-based exercises work well too, since the water supports your body weight while letting you move freely.
Regular aerobic exercise, roughly two and a half hours per week, supports recovery by improving circulation and helping with weight management, both of which reduce knee stress. With consistent effort, most people see meaningful improvement within three to six months.
When Surgery Is Recommended
Surgery becomes the better option when the knee locks frequently, when symptoms don’t improve with physical therapy, or when the tear pattern is unlikely to heal on its own. Two main procedures exist, and the choice between them depends heavily on where the tear sits within the meniscus and how old you are.
Only about 25% of the meniscus receives blood flow. This outer rim, called the red zone, can heal when stitched back together because blood delivers the oxygen and nutrients needed for tissue repair. Tears in this zone are candidates for meniscus repair, where the surgeon sutures the torn edges together. The remaining 75% of the meniscus has no blood supply (the white zone), so repairs in that area tend to fail. Tears here are usually treated with partial meniscectomy, where the surgeon trims away the damaged portion and leaves the rest intact.
Younger patients are more likely to get a repair when possible, because preserving as much meniscus as you can protects the joint long-term. Both procedures are done arthroscopically through small incisions.
Recovery After Surgery
Recovery from a partial meniscectomy is relatively quick. Most people return to normal activities within a few weeks because the meniscus doesn’t need time to heal together, just to settle down from the procedure.
Meniscus repair requires a longer, more structured recovery. For the first three weeks, you’ll be on partial weight-bearing with crutches and limited to bending the knee less than 90 degrees. That restriction continues through about week six, when most surgeons allow you to ditch the crutches and brace, provided your quadriceps are strong enough and your walking pattern looks normal. By nine to twelve weeks, the goal is full range of motion matching your other knee. Sport-specific training starts around three to five months, and unrestricted return to sports, including hard cutting and pivoting, typically happens at six months or later, progressing from non-contact practice to full practice to full play.
Long-Term Joint Health
One of the most important things to understand about a meniscus tear is its relationship to osteoarthritis down the road. Losing meniscus tissue, whether from the original injury or from surgical trimming, changes how forces are distributed across the knee. A study tracking patients aged 16 to 45 in Sweden found that the absolute risk of developing symptomatic knee osteoarthritis was 17% after partial meniscectomy, 10% after meniscus repair, and just 2.3% in the general population. That’s a significant gap, and it’s a major reason surgeons prefer repair over removal when the tear location and blood supply allow it.
Keeping the muscles around your knee strong, maintaining a healthy weight, and staying active with low-impact exercise are the most effective ways to protect the joint after any meniscus injury, whether you had surgery or not.
